Day & Ross is one of Canada’s largest transportation companies, serving top brands across North America. We got our start hauling potatoes in 1950, and now we have a team of more than 8,000 employees, drivers and owner operators.

We believe our people are our greatest strength – and we treat them like family. For over a decade, we’ve been recognized as one of Canada’s Best Managed Companies, and we have been named a Top Company for Women to Work for in Transportation every year since 2018. Our industry recognition is a testament to the family values we share with our parent company, McCain Foods Limited.

About the Role

Continuous Improvement Specialist
Full-time
Hartland, NB

This role will support the growth of Day & Ross business continuous improvement process developing the rigor and commitment to the business units and functions across North America. This role will act as a business partner by driving process improvements for greater efficiency, speed of execution, and cost savings.

How You’ll Help

-Partner with various Day & Ross business and functional units to plan and execute CI initiatives
-Provide expert level advice and guidance for process improvement using Business Process Management methodologies
-Lead and facilitate improvement projects and workshops
-Serve as a data and/or analytic resource for initiative-based teams
-Lead change management and calculate ROI (return on investment)

Your Skills & Experience:

-Education Required: Post-secondary Degree in a Business, Engineering, or equivalent
-Experience working with data visualization and analytics tools would be considered an asset
-5-7 years related experience; preference being a lean workplace
-Proven track record of innovation, ingenuity, attention to detail, ownership and willingness to seek and take on challenges
-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al
-Ability to analyze problems/opportunities for efficiencies and make recommendations for improvements
-Lean Six Sigma Green Belt certification or equivalent Continuous Improvement methodologies
-Project management skills, including the ability to manage multiple tasks and priorities
-Critical thinking, synthesis and diagnostics capability
-English; French and Spanish are assets
